    This listing is for the ATi f12/D Gas transmitter The units are in full working condition and ready for immediate use ATi F12/D Gas Transmitter Overview The Series F12D Gas Transmitter is designed for detection of a variety of toxic gases in hazardous area applications. In addition, it is also well suited for general-purpose environments where toxic gas measurement is required. The F12D is highly customizable, making it adaptable to nearly every fixed-mount toxic gas monitoring application. Key Features Extensive Gas Detection Supports over 60 interchangeable electrochemical sensors for detecting gases such as chlorine, ammonia, hydrogen sulfide, formaldehyde, nitric oxide, phosgene, and more. Auto-Test Function An integrated Auto-Test system uses a real gas sample to verify sensor function—eliminating the need for manual bump tests and ensuring operational integrity. Smart Sensor Technology H10 Smart Sensors store their own calibration data and can be swapped out in the field without recalibration, reducing maintenance time and cost. Rugged, Durable Design The F12D features a polycarbonate enclosure with stainless steel hardware, IP65 ingress protection, and is corrosion-resistant for harsh environments. Flexible Power Supply Options Operates on 12–24 VDC, 115 VAC, or 230 VAC to suit various site requirements. Communication Capabilities Offers RS-232/485 output and optional HART® or Modbus RTU for seamless integration into digital control systems. Highly Customizable for Diverse Applications The F12D offers broad configuration options, making it suitable for: Hazardous Areas (e.g., chemical plants, refineries) General Industrial Use (e.g., wastewater treatment, food & beverage, laboratories) Customization Options Include: Sensor Holder Styles Integral mount Remote mount (6 ft cable) Duct mount Auto-Test Gas Generators Available for chlorine, ammonia, hydrogen sulfide, sulfur dioxide, and others. Digital Interface Upgrades Optional HART and Modbus interfaces for advanced integration and data transmission
